Rosemary Focaccia is a classic Italian bread known for its fluffy texture and aromatic flavor. Perfect as a side dish or snack, this bread is simple to prepare and always impresses with its rustic charm.

Ingredients:

  • 500 grams of all-purpose flour
  • 5 tablespoons of vegetable oil
  • ½ tablespoon of salt
  • 1 block of bread yeast
  • 1 cup of lukewarm water
  • 2 tablespoons of dried rosemary
  • ½ cup of coarse salt

Preparation:
In a bowl, mix 50 grams of flour with the yeast dissolved in ½ cup of lukewarm water to form a paste. Cover with a cloth and let it rise. In a larger bowl, combine the remaining 450 grams of flour with the oil, salt, yeast paste, and a bit more lukewarm water. Knead by hand until you achieve a smooth dough. Spread the rosemary evenly over the dough and form it into a ball. Allow it to rise in a warm place for 1 hour. Roll out the dough into a circle 3 to 4 centimeters thick. Brush the surface with oil and sprinkle with coarse salt. Bake in a hot oven for 20 minutes.
